U.S. event linen rental company Creative Coverings, based in Sparks, Nev., has implemented several sustainable components within its manufacturing, shipping and laundry departments. These include: Repurposing damaged linens (creating alternate size table coverings, table accents, client swatches). Special Event Rentals, Edmonton, Alberta, Canada, provided tenting for the Truth and Reconciliation Commission of Canada’s National Event, June 28–July 1, 2011, in Inuvik, Northwest Territories. Eco-tent designed for ‘green’ mountaintop music festival. Organizers of Eco Music Festival (EMU), held over the Fourth of July weekend at Snowmass Village, Colo., scrutinized every event detail for sustainability: biodegradable bottles and utensils, sustainable food vendors, carbon offsets and, naturally, an eco-friendly festival tent. Stretch tents are popular
October 1st, 2011
Fabric developments and growing popularity advance market potential for freeform style tents. Stretch or freeform style tents originated in the “trance” electronic dance music movement in the 1990s.
